i really like the new oxygen icons but the lancelot shelf seems to disagree..
well... not completely .. some folders get the new icons, some stay with the old ones.. and a little bit strange... when hovering over the folders with the old icons i can see the new ones and vice versa? does this make any sense? is there something like a lancelot icon cache i have to delete ? thx in advance! try these - switch to a different icon set then switch back to oxygen or delete ~/.kde/cache-user_name.site/icon-cache.kcache

thx.. now the icon confusion in dolphin is gone.. lancelot still shows old icons when hovering over the new ones..
do you know about any lancelot specific icon cache?

try the command: kbuildsycoca4 --noincremental
try restarting KDE try removing then re-adding the Lancelot widget |

after kbuildsycocoa4 and restarting kde the problem is gone.. thx very much !
